Problems solved by technology

[0004] At present, most of the various sleep monitoring devices or equipment on the market only have the monitoring function, but no sleep aid function; for example, the existing smart pillow is equipped with a brain wave monitoring device, which can only be used to determine whether the user enters the Sleep status or insomnia status is monitored, and the monitoring results are statistically analyzed to provide users with big data analysis results; another example: commonly used smart wearable devices (such as smart bracelets), through the action feature analysis and recording module, identify The number of times the user turns over, the state of sleep snoring, the number of times of waking up from sleep, and the number of times of insomnia are used to detect whether the user is in a sleep state; the above two existing technologies can only detect sleep, and cannot improve or improve the user's sleep. Embodiment 1

[0071] figure 1 It is a schematic structural diagram of an intelligent sleep aid device based on real-time sleep monitoring and breathing frequency adjustment provided by Embodiment 1 of the present invention; figure 1 As shown, an intelligent sleep aid device based on real-time sleep monitoring and respiratory rate adjustment, including:

[0072] Respiratory collection module 1: used to collect the breathing sound of the user;

[0073] Controller 2: its input end is electrically connected to the signal output end of the breathing acquisition module 1, and is used to receive the user's breathing sound, judge the user's sleep state according to the breathing sound, and output sleep aid instructions according to the user's sleep state;

[0074] Storage module 3: bidirectionally connected with the controller 2, on which an audio file database is stored, and the audio file database includes: a sleep state, a breathing guide audio file corresponding to the sleep state;

Abstract

The invention provides an intelligent sleep-assisting device and method based on real-time sleep monitoring and respiratory frequency regulation. The intelligent sleep-assisting method comprises the following steps of: collecting the respiratory sound of a user; receiving the respiratory sound of the user, according to the respiratory sound, judging the sleep state of the user, and according to the sleep state of the user, outputting a sleep-assisting instruction; and according to the sleep-assisting instruction, reading and playing a respiratory guiding voice frequency file corresponding to the sleep state in the storage module to enable the user to regulate an own respiratory rhythm according to the respiratory guiding voice frequency file, wherein the storage module stores a voice frequency file database, the voice frequency file database comprises a sleep state and the respiratory guiding voice frequency file corresponding to the sleep state, and the sleep state includes awakening,falling asleep, light sleep and deep sleep. The intelligent sleep-assisting device has the beneficial effects that a sleep assisting effect can be effectively improved and the health situation of theuser can be effectively managed and analyzed, and the intelligent sleep-assisting device is suitable for the technical field of sleep assisting.
